Trauma & Unattended Death Cleanup
When a death goes undiscovered for days or weeks, decomposition fluids follow gravity and moisture. In a North Branch basement with a rising water table, those fluids wick into carpet pad, drywall, tack strip, and even the porous concrete itself. We seal the affected area under negative air, remove contaminated materials to the studs where necessary, disinfect all remaining surfaces, and verify with ATP testing before we call the job done. No fog-and-paint shortcuts.

Blood & Bodily Fluid Cleanup
Blood spills in a North Branch home with a finished basement present a specific problem: fluids run along the slab slope, collect behind baseboards, and seep under cove joints. We remove affected trim, cut drywall where the moisture map shows contamination, treat the subfloor, and replace what we removed. Our technicians carry the full PPE suite and follow OSHA bloodborne pathogen protocols on every job, no matter how small the visible stain looks.

Hoarding Cleanup
Hoarding environments in North Branch’s boom-era homes often hide water damage beneath the debris. Cracked drain tile, failed sump pits, and years of landscape settlement mean the basement floor under a hoard has often been wet for a long time. We clear the contents with respect for the homeowner, sort what can be salvaged, then address the underlying moisture and mold before sanitizing. Without that step, the bacteria and odors come back. We don’t hand a homeowner a half-finished job.

Infectious Disease Disinfection
After an illness outbreak, a public exposure event, or a contaminated flood, you need more than household cleaners. We use EPA-registered hospital-grade disinfectants applied with dwell times that actually kill pathogens, then verify with surface testing. For North Branch homes with high basement humidity, we run dehumidification from XPOWER or B-Air units during and after treatment so the disinfectant has a dry, stable surface to work on.

Common Biohazard & Crime Scene Cleanup Problems We See in North Branch Homes
- Wicking through finished basement drywall and carpet pad. North Branch’s high water table means decomposition fluids and blood don’t stay where they land. They migrate along the slab, into wall cavities, and under flooring. Surface cleaning leaves the hidden reservoir behind.
- Contamination trapped behind vinyl baseboards and cove joints. The boom-era subdivisions were built fast, often with lower-grade moisture barriers. Fluids settle behind trim and under the joints where mop-and-disinfect routines never reach. We remove trim, treat the gap, and replace it.
- Biohazard jobs layered on top of failed drain tile. In many 1990s-era North Branch homes, the original undersized drainage tile has cracked or offset after decades of freeze-thaw heaving. The water isn’t a one-time event. We document it, flag it for repair before restoration finishes, and work with the homeowner on a sequence that doesn’t just repeat next spring.
- Odor returning after a fog-and-paint cleanup. We’ve seen it in nearly every North Branch subdivision: a crew fogs, repaints, and leaves, and the smell comes back within weeks. The cause is almost always contamination left in the slab or behind drywall that fog never reached. Our method removes the source, then treats.
Pricing for Biohazard & Crime Scene Cleanup in North Branch, MN
Biohazard cleanup in North Branch runs on square footage, contamination depth, and whether water is involved, which in Chisago County it often is. A straightforward blood cleanup in a single room typically runs $800 to $1,500. An unattended death scene with moderate decomposition in a finished basement generally lands between $2,500 and $5,500 when drywall removal and subfloor treatment are required. Hoarding cleanup in a North Branch basement starts around $1,800 for a small space and climbs to $8,000 or more for a full 1,000-square-foot lower level with mold remediation included. Infectious disease disinfection for a whole home typically runs $1,200 to $3,000 depending on square footage and surface types. Every job starts with a written scope and upfront pricing before work begins.
